German wrestler Karl Groß of Ludwigshafen finished seventh at the 1910 and third at the 1911 Unofficial Greco-Roman World Championships in Stuttgart as a light-heavyweight. At the 1912 Stockholm Olympics Groß was eliminated in the second round against Finnish wrestler Ivar Böhling. No more results from Groß could be identified.
